Students at the most prestigious academies in the world shoot
documentaries in Western Serbia in the second half of August during the
6th “Interaction“
Požega, 2nd August 2011 - 6th International Student Film Camp
“Interaction 2011” is going to be held from 11th to 29th August 2011 in
Pozega with the aim of improving cooperation, building mutual trust,
tolerance and recognizing the filmmaking of the young. During the camp,
twenty students at film academies from 17 countries are going to make
four documentaries on the theme “Art Dialogue”. In addition to film
production, there are also several accompanying activities: film
screenings, culture presentation of the participating countries,
exhibitions, literary evenings, workshops, excursions, parties and
sporting activities.
The participants,
divided into four crews are going to make four documentaries in
municipalities of Cacak, Uzice, Kosjeric and Pozega. At the same time
with the editing stage, from 20th to 26th August,
“INTERface” and
“INTERscreen” programmes are going to be
organized at Pozega Art Gallery. Within “INTERface”, the participants
present the culture of the country they are from, while “INTERscreen”
programme is about screening of the students’ films as well as the films
awarded at “CILECT PRIZE 2010” Festival (CILECT - International
Association of Film and Television Schools).
Documentaries “Cinema
komunisto” by Mila Turajlic and “Milena” by Carna Radojicic are also in
“INTERscreen” programme.
Kajoko Jamasaki, a poetess
from Japan is having a
poetry evening “Under the
silent stars” at Pozega Art Gallery on 19th August.
On the occasion of the
beginning of this year’s camp, the opening of
“Art dialogue”
exhibition
by Bozidar Plazinic is at
Pozega Art Gallery on 11th August.
The premiere of the films
made during the camp is at Pozega Cultural Centre, Movie Theatre on 27th
August and at Belgrade Cultural Centre a day after.
For the first time,
simultaneously with the editing stage, there is also a seven-day
International Documentary Masterclass
“INTERdoc”.
11 participants of the masterclass are going to have lectures on
“Creative documentary film” by MA professor Dragan Elcic and Mila
Turajlic.
During their stay in the camp, the participants are going to visit
cultural and historical sites in Western Serbia (Mokra Gora, Sirogojno,
Ovcarsko-Kablarska Gorge).
With the aim of socializing, music and sports events are going to be
organized every day. The camp organizer is Independent Film Centre
“Filmart” and general sponsors are the Ministry of Culture, media and
information society, Central European Initiative (CEI) and Municipality
of Pozega. |
